Senior Management Team

George Feiger, Chief Executive Officer
George M. Feiger brings a diverse background in the banking, financial services and wealth-management industries to Contango. Mr. Feiger is also executive vice president of the firm's parent company, Zions Bancorporation.

Prior to Contango, Mr. Feiger served in a number of senior positions in the financial services sector. He was a senior advisor to the Monitor Group, Global Head of Onshore Private Banking for UBS, Global Head of Investment Banking at SBC Warburg and was a senior partner at McKinsey & Co. During his time in Europe, Mr. Feiger led the merger integration of the corporate finance businesses of Swiss Bank Corp. and SG Warburg, and oversaw the consolidation of SBC Warburg's sales and trading businesses. Mr. Feiger was also a partner at Capco, a financial services consulting firm.

Mr. Feiger holds a PhD in Economics from Harvard University and was an associate professor of Finance at Stanford University's Graduate School of Business.

Perry Piazza, Director of Investment Strategy
Perry Piazza develops and implements both return-oriented and hedge-related trading strategies. Mr. Piazza brings significant US and international trading and financial market experience to Contango. Prior to joining the firm, Mr. Piazza worked at First New York Securities, a proprietary trading firm in New York. Earlier, Mr. Piazza was a derivatives trader for Citigroup in New York and London, and was co-manager of the London trading desk. At Citigroup, he specialized in the commodities markets, analyzing and developing customer and proprietary trading strategies across the energy and metals sectors. He also traded on the interest-rate and foreign-exchange markets. In addition, Mr. Piazza served as an international equity arbitrage analyst at Bear Stearns and a fixed-income analyst at Morgan Stanley.

Mr. Piazza holds an MBA from the Yale School of Management and a BS from the University of Delaware.

Julianne Cruz, Managing Director of Advisory Services
Julianne Cruz has 20 years of experience in the financial services industry. Before joining Contango, she launched the Wealth Management and Trust Division of First Federal Bank in Santa Monica, CA. Prior to that, she was manager of Private Client Services for City National Bank in Beverly Hills, managed shareholder and dealer services for Great Western Financial Services, and was branch manager for BankAmerica's broker-dealer.

Ms. Cruz holds a BA from California State University, Fullerton. She is a Certified Financial Planner and holds various investment and securities licenses.

Kevin Mikan, Head of Contango's Wealth Planning Group, President of Western National Trust Company
Kevin Mikan supervises the design of integrated financial solutions for the firm's clientele. Mr. Mikan brings to Contango substantial experience leading wealth management operations for major financial institutions. Most recently, he served as head of the UBS Wealth Management division covering the western United States. In this capacity, he led the firm's comprehensive estate, tax, philanthropic and business succession advisory team. After UBS acquired PaineWebber, Mr. Mikan helped integrate the combined firm's products and services. Earlier Mr. Mikan held positions at major public accounting firms including Arthur Andersen and PricewaterhouseCoopers, where he provided tax and estate-planning advice to high net-worth clients.

Mr. Mikan holds a JD from University of the Pacific, McGeorge School of Law, and received a BA from Loyola Marymount University.

Faraz Sattar, Chief Financial Officer
Faraz Sattar oversees Contango’s financial management and reporting and business analysis. Prior to joining Contango in October 2004, Mr. Sattar headed his own consultant practice. In that capacity he built financial models for Wells Fargo’s Consumer Credit Group, and was instrumental in developing the business plan for Protelligence, Inc., a systems monitoring software company. Before that, Mr. Sattar was with Montgomery Asset Management, first as the company’s finance manager and later as a buy-side equity analyst. His industry career started in operations at Wells Fargo.

Mr. Sattar holds a BS in finance from Bryant College in Rhode Island.
